A traditional college student is defined as being between the ages of 18-21. At Grossmont College, 45.1% of undergraduate students fall into that category, compared to the national average of 60%.
| Student Age Group | Number | Percent |
|---|---|---|
| 18-19 | 4,057 | 28.1% |
| 20-21 | 2,458 | 17.0% |
| 35 and over | 2,090 | 14.5% |
| 22-24 | 1,758 | 12.2% |
| 25-29 | 1,597 | 11.1% |
| Under 18 | 1,451 | 10.0% |
| 30-34 | 1,029 | 7.1% |
